## Bulk Edit Limits — Ledgerly Admin Table

Bulk edits in the admin table are throttled server-side to protect the audit-log writer. Requests above the row cap are rejected outright, not truncated, so retries are safe. If on-call sees sustained 429s from the bulk endpoint, check whether a partner script is ignoring the batch size header before raising any limits. The current enforced values are shown below.

limits module of fajog-tawig:
RATE_LIMITS = {
    "druwyn": 2,
    "quenael": 10,
    "wenix": 2,
    "druael": 2,
}

# Nightly search reindex for the Marletto catalog. Runs after the
# import pipeline settles; starting earlier risks indexing partial
# batches. Each shard rebuilds independently, and a failed shard
# retries without blocking the others. If paging alerts fire, check
# shard lag before touching anything here. The tunables below control
# batch size, concurrency, and retry windows. Current values:

constants for bawif-kawif:
QUOTAS = {
    "ulaael": 5,
    "holael": 10,
}

Thanks for flagging the rebuild path. Incremental rebuilds in Stonepress only touch pages whose content hash changed, and the invalidation queue is signed per worker, so a poisoned entry can't trigger arbitrary writes. I also capped fan-out so one edit can't enqueue unbounded jobs. For your review, the limits enforcing that are defined immediately below.

tuning constants:
QUOTAS = {
    "druwyn": 5,
    "holix": 5,
    "zorath": 5,
    "holwyn": 10,
}

## Releases

Slimline builds are produced by the trim pipeline, which strips debug symbols, dedupes layers, and rebases images onto the minimal Garnet base. Before promoting a slimmed image, verify the size report in the build artifacts and confirm no runtime libraries were removed — the Oakfell incident started exactly that way. Promotion to the production registry requires a signed manifest; unsigned images are quarantined automatically. To sign the manifest, use the release key below.

rollout seal: bky4_DFM9